Subject: [PATCH v2 2/3] staging/fbtft: Remove unnecessary variable initialization
Date: Sat, 24 Jul 2021 17:14:10 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20210724151411.9531-3-len.baker@gmx.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20210724151411.9531-1-len.baker@gmx.com>

Remove the initialization of the variable "i" since it is written a few
lines later.

Signed-off-by: Len Baker <len.baker@gmx.com>
---
 drivers/staging/fbtft/fbtft-core.c | 2 +-
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/drivers/staging/fbtft/fbtft-core.c b/drivers/staging/fbtft/fbtft-core.c
index be20da3c4a5c..cc2bee22f7ad 100644
--- a/drivers/staging/fbtft/fbtft-core.c
+++ b/drivers/staging/fbtft/fbtft-core.c
@@ -992,7 +992,7 @@ static int fbtft_init_display_from_property(struct fbtft_par *par)
 int fbtft_init_display(struct fbtft_par *par)
 {
 	int buf[64];
-	int i = 0;
+	int i;
 	int j;

 	/* sanity check */
